Strictly's former judge Arlene Phillips and Bake Off's Prue Leith made DAMES by Queen

Strictly Come Dancing judge Arlene Phillips is to be celebrated in the Queen's Birthday honours list.The 78-year dancer and choreographer, who was a judge on the BBC ballroom dancing show from 2004-2008, will be made a Dame.The TV star received an OBE in 2001 and was appointed a Commander of the Order of the British Empire (CBE) eight years ago.She was given the accolade in the New Years Honours for services to dance and charity.Over her impressive career, Arlene has choreographed a number of hit West End shows from Starlight Express to Grease.She also worked on Saturday Night Fever, We Will Rock You and more recently The Cher Show.Fellow TV personality Prue Leith will also be made a Dame by the Queen.The 81-year-old chef followed in the.
